U.S. patent number D461,241 [Application Number D/145,920] was granted by the patent office on 2002-08-06 for infusion pump for delivery of fluid. This patent grant is currently assigned to Medtronic MiniMed, Inc.. Invention is credited to Sheldon B. Moberg, Timothy J. Payne.
